High-ranking military commander in Sudan army killed in Nyala

WORLD, Aug 22 (YPA) – A high-ranking military commander in the Sudan’s army has been killed during fights in the city of Nyala in Sudan, the country’s army said on Monday.

In the statement, The Sudan’s army mourned the death of Maj-Gen Yasser Fadlallah, commander of the 16th Infantry Division in Nyala, South Darfur.

According to the statement, he was killed in Nyala on Monday while “carrying out his holy duty to defend the nation.”

The statement gave no more details, but the army and the Rapid Support Forces ( RSF) have been fighting in Nyala in recent days.
